Product Description

By using a Philips Sonicare toothbrush will give you cleaner and fresher teeth, healthier gums, and much improved overall oral health. Sonicare toothbrushes offer several features to make brushing your teeth simpler and far more effective than other leading brands of electric toothbrush. This is due to the fact a Philips Sonicare toothbrush has a patented cleansing action which removes plaque from below the gum line and in-between teeth. This method of cleaning your teeth is proven to remove harsh stubborn stains (such as those from nicotine and coffee) and additionally to whiten your teeth by a number of shades in just two weeks of use.

 

Sonicare is the only Sonic powered toothbrush with a long and slim angled neck, specially designed bristles and high speed brush head and bristle speed for much improved plaque removal in the difficult to reach areas of the mouth. Sonicare's unique dynamic cleaning method gently but effectively cleans deep between teeth and below gumline for a brushing experience akin to no other powered toothbrush. A Philips Sonicare toothbrush arrives in the box with handy colour coded replacement heads.

 

The Philips Sonicare toothbrush offers an abundance of features to ensure your dental teeth hygiene routine is easier and more effective than ever before. The presense of a built-in timer to remind you when you have been brushing for 2 minutes is a good example of just one of the benefits. The electric toothbrush also massages your gums thereby stimulating blood circulation in and around the mouth area which helps to dislodge plaque located along the gum line. An interesting point to remember with a Philips Sonicare Toothbrush is the bristle tips at a rate of  31,000 brush revolutions each minute, meaning a very clean and thorough clean every time.

 

Philips Sonicare toothbrush heads will provide you with outstanding cleaning capabilities but do remember to replace the tooth brush heads at least every six months. Finally, Sonicare toothbrushes are now clinically verified to help reduce the instances of gingivitis, helping to significantly improve your oral health routine.

Product Details

  • Soft-grip handle holds charge for up to 2 weeks, ideal for travel"
  • Rechargeable toothbrush cleans with ultra-high speed bristles
  • 2-minute Smartimer and Quadpacer interval timer
  • Removes 80% of coffee and tobacco stains in just 28 days
  • Includes 2 contoured brush heads, charger base, and travel case

I had an old-school sonicare that I loved. Even my dentist/hygenist noticed a huge difference once I started using the sonicare, my teeth were whiter and she found she did less scrapping and cleaning than her other patients. When the battery died after 4 yrs, there was no question that I was getting another one. These new ones are great, they are more powerful than my old brush, and the smaller angled brush head actually seems to work better.

I picked the e5500 over the e7300 for several reasons. Both have the smartimer and quadpacer features that I depend on, and for the extra $10, you only get a recharge indicator on the e7300. I don't need that, since I recharge it every couple of days, and I appreciate the extra brush head that comes with the e5500.

FYI, if you've never owned a sonicare before, it takes a while to get used to, but you do get used to it. And you have to unscrew the brush from the base and clean both parts regularly (I do about once every week).
